A Typhoon-strengthening Method Based On Scatterometer Data

A typhoon intensity estimation technique based on scatterometer wind data is proposed in this study.The purpose of the proposed method is to eliminate the error caused by high wind speeds in the form of averaging the sea surface wind speed in the sea area where the typhoon is located.The mean of wind speed computed in a specific circular area over the sea surface,is defined as the key parameter that defines the typhoon intensity.The mean value,M,which defined as the key parameter that defines the typhoon intensity,is determined from the wind field associated with every stage of typhoon formation.The center of the specific circular area is the typhoon center,and the radius of the specific circular area is K times of the radius of maximum wind.The technique is verified by typhoon cases from the HY-2 Satellite scatterometer data.The method proposed in this study can eliminate the error caused by high wind speeds,and proved to be effective for determining typhoon intensity for cases under Severe Typhoon category,as compared with historical typhoon records.For cases where the typhoon intensity is higher than the intensity level of Severe Typhoon,the article proposes a conjecture for determining the strength based on the method proposed in this study.
